Amashuketi — A Cozy Haven in the Kharagauli Mountains
In the Imereti region, within the Kharagauli Municipality, lies the village of Amashuketi. Built at an elevation of 454 meters above sea level, this settlement is one of the quiet and picturesque villages of the region. Geography and Nature
The village is built on mountainous terrain. The local landscape is rich in dense forests and mountain meadows. The climate is healthy—with cool summers and snowy winters, creating the best conditions for those seeking mountain air and closeness to nature. Local Lifestyle
Today, more than 110 people live in Amashuketi. The daily life of the population is closely tied to farming and animal husbandry. The village is distinguished by its hospitality and the special Imeretian spirit that characterizes the local environment.
